1、活動
是一個可以包含用戶界面的組件,主要用於和用戶就行交互。
2、廣播
進行系統級別的消息通知
3、內容提供器
主要用於在不同的應用程序之間實現數據共享,它提供了一套完整的機制,允許一個程序訪問另一個程序的數據,同時能保證被訪數據的安全性。
4、服務
實現程序后台運行的解決方案,執行那些不需要和用戶交互需要長期運行的任務
服務並不會開啟多線程,所有的代碼默認運行在主線程當中。也就是說需要在服務內部手動創建子線程,否則會阻塞主線程。
1、活動
是一個可以包含用戶界面的組件,主要用於和用戶就行交互。
2、廣播
進行系統級別的消息通知
3、內容提供器
主要用於在不同的應用程序之間實現數據共享,它提供了一套完整的機制,允許一個程序訪問另一個程序的數據,同時能保證被訪數據的安全性。
4、服務
實現程序后台運行的解決方案,執行那些不需要和用戶交互需要長期運行的任務
服務並不會開啟多線程,所有的代碼默認運行在主線程當中。也就是說需要在服務內部手動創建子線程,否則會阻塞主線程。
本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。